I've just bough the South East Finecast kit for the Met Railway brake van, it's a lovely kit, nice crisp casting with not too much flash at all, and goes together very nicely. there's no instructions with the kit but it's all common sense where it all goes! But doe anyone have a photo of the real thing or a drawing so I know where the handrails need to go? did it have spilt spoke or solid spoke wheels?
It'll go nicely with my F class loco that is now underway after a gap of about 30 years. I'm using the Finecast etched chassis with a High Level Gears drive chain and motor.

I assume we are talking about the smaller 10T vans not the longer Ballast Brakes or the ex WD 20T ones? There are photos in James Snowdon’s Met Rly Rolling Stoke book if you have that. There’s also this layout which is surperb! The brake van there looks pretty spot on in all areas. bambrickstudio.co.uk/whitchurch-road-2/I bought an old LMS brake to use as a donor for the chassis and roof and was intending to scratch build the sides. The chassis will need to be shortened but it makes the job easier.

The brake van there has differences to the Finecast version which has a wheeled handbrake stand rather than a cranked handle, and the handrails and lamp bracket positions differ. A letter pic shows the LT variant didn't have side lamp brackets, just an off-centre rear bracket. I don't have a copy of the Met Railway rolling stock book.
